Trim Installation in Wilmington, NC
Trim installation services involve fitting and attaching molding, baseboards, crown molding, and other decorative or functional trim elements to interior or exterior spaces. These projects typically include upgrading or replacing existing trim, adding new trim to enhance architectural details, or customizing spaces such as living rooms, bedrooms, hallways, and outdoor facades. Homeowners often request this service when aiming to improve the appearance of a room, achieve a more finished look, or update their property's style. Before requesting trim installation, property owners should consider the type of trim desired, the scope of the project, and how the new or replacement trim will coordinate with existing interior or exterior design elements.
Understanding the different styles and materials available, such as wood, MDF, or composite options, can help inform choices that suit the property's aesthetic and functional needs. It’s also useful to clarify the measurements and the specific areas where trim will be installed, ensuring an accurate fit and seamless look. Homeowners typically want to know about the installation process, the expected finish quality, and any preparation needed prior to work beginning. Clear communication about these details can help facilitate a smooth project and a result that complements the property's overall style.

Common Trim Installation Jobs
Interior trim installation - adds finishing touches to enhance room aesthetics and detail.
Door trim installation - provides a clean, polished look around door frames.
Crown molding installation - elevates room style with decorative ceiling accents.
Baseboard installation - improves room appearance and protects walls from damage.
Window trim installation - frames windows for improved appearance and insulation.
Custom trim work - creates unique design elements tailored to property styles.
Trim Installation Questions
What types of trim can be installed? Common options include baseboards, crown molding, window casings, and door trim to enhance interior spaces.
Is trim installation suitable for all home styles? Yes, trim can complement a variety of architectural styles and interior designs.
What should homeowners consider before installing new trim? It's important to choose a style that matches the space and to ensure proper measurements for a clean fit.
Can trim be added to existing structures? Yes, trim can be installed on existing walls, doors, and windows to improve appearance and detail.
